Web Development Explained: Everything You Need to Know

web development

Web development is one of the fastest-growing tech fields today. Whether you want to build your own website, start a tech career, or understand how the digital world works, learning web development opens countless opportunities. In this guide, you’ll learn what web development is, how websites are built, the skills you need, and the best technologies used by professionals.


What Is Web Development?

Web development refers to the process of creating, building, and maintaining websites or web applications. It includes everything from designing how a website looks (frontend) to how it works behind the scenes (backend).

✔ Three Main Components of Web Development

  1. Frontend Development – What users see and interact with.
  2. Backend Development – The logic, database, and server-side operations.
  3. Full-Stack Development – A combination of both frontend and backend.

1. Frontend Development (Client Side)

Frontend development focuses on the visual and interactive part of a website. It ensures the layout, buttons, fonts, colors, animations, and overall user experience function properly.

Core Frontend Languages

  • HTML — Structures the web page.
  • CSS — Styles the content.
  • JavaScript — Adds interactivity and logic.

Popular Frontend Frameworks

  • React
  • Angular
  • Vue.js

Key Frontend Concepts

  • Responsive design (mobile-friendly websites)
  • Web performance optimization
  • Browser compatibility
  • UI/UX fundamentals

2. Backend Development (Server Side)

Backend development powers everything that happens behind the scenes — managing data, users, authentication, and logic.

Backend Languages

Common server-side languages include:

  • Python
  • PHP
  • Java
  • Ruby
  • C#
  • JavaScript (Node.js)

Popular Backend Frameworks

  • Django (Python)
  • Laravel (PHP)
  • Spring Boot (Java)
  • Ruby on Rails (Ruby)
  • Express.js (Node.js)

Databases Used

  • MySQL
  • MongoDB
  • PostgreSQL
  • SQLite

3. Full-Stack Development

Full-stack developers handle both frontend and backend tasks. They can build complete, functional web applications from start to finish.

Popular full-stack stacks include:

  • MERN (MongoDB, Express.js, React, Node.js)
  • MEAN (MongoDB, Express.js, Angular, Node.js)
  • LAMP (Linux, Apache, MySQL, PHP)

How Websites Are Built: Step-by-Step

  1. Planning & Research
    Understanding the goals, audience, and functionality.
  2. Designing the UI/UX
    Creating layouts, color schemes, and page structure.
  3. Frontend Development
    Turning design into a real webpage.
  4. Backend Development
    Building databases, APIs, servers, and application logic.
  5. Testing
    Checking performance, bugs, responsiveness, and speed.
  6. Deployment
    Publishing the website on hosting platforms like
    • Netlify
    • Vercel
    • GitHub Pages
    • Cloud servers like AWS, Google Cloud, or Azure.

Why Web Development Is Important

  • Every business needs an online presence.
  • Websites remain the primary trust-building platform.
  • Web apps power e-commerce, banking, healthcare, education, and more.
  • Skilled developers are in high demand globally.

Career Opportunities in Web Development

Here are some popular job roles:

✔ Frontend Developer
✔ Backend Developer
✔ Full-Stack Developer
✔ UI/UX Designer
✔ Web Designer
✔ DevOps Engineer
✔ Web Application Tester


Skills You Need to Become a Web Developer

  • Strong understanding of HTML, CSS, and JavaScript
  • Problem-solving and logical thinking
  • Knowledge of frameworks like React or Angular
  • Understanding of databases and APIs
  • Version control with Git/GitHub
  • Continuous learning mindset

Final Thoughts

Web development is a powerful, rewarding, and future-proof skill in the digital era. Whether you’re a beginner or someone looking to advance your career, now is the perfect time to dive into building websites and applications.

Leave a Reply

Your email address will not be published. Required fields are marked *

Form submitted! Our team will reach out to you soon.
Form submitted! Our team will reach out to you soon.
0
    0
    Your Cart
    Your cart is emptyReturn to Course